What can I see and do near Brunswick Naval Aviation Museum?
Bowdoin College Museum of Art, Arctic Museum and Arctic Studies Center, and Peary-MacMillan Arctic Museum feature a variety of fascinating exhibits to see while you're in town. Harriet Beecher Stowe House, First Parish Church, and Joshua L. Chamberlain Museum are some of the local landmarks to explore. You can enjoy live performances at Maine State Music Theater and Pickard Theater.
